I'm not sure about that one. I've purchased a new Chevy & Dodge trucks in the past and had zero hassle compared to what I'm going thru now. I've had 3 deals go bad now while trying to pay almost $70k for a car that is a want far more than a need. I made deals with all 3 to pay MSRP for a '13 GT500 that took a deposit and then when it came time to sign the paperwork I get the good old "well market demand has really shot up on these cars and we need to charge you $5-10k over sticker (one owner actually said he was going to charge "$20k over sticker once the old man croaks").

This has been by far the worst purchasing experience that I've ever had!! I feel a bit discouraged about making future Ford purchase if this is the way their dealers operate. We were looking at buying a new Ford pickup for the wife if/after the GT500 ever shows up but that is on hold for now. What makes things a bit more frustrating is the fact that numerous people have made GT500 orders after me and have either already received their cars, awaiting delivery or have an actual build date and VIN number, which I have none of

I think I've finally found a dealer that is going to honor their deal @ MSRP. I sent Deysha all of my order info and details last night in hopes that she may be the only one to provide me with some answers.

I keep telling myself that it will all be worth it in the end. Just needed to vent, thanks guys!

I’ll check it for you, myfast70. Please remember, the Shelby is part of our Specialty Vehicle line and production/availability can vary from the typical ordering time frames. The dealers get allocation for SVT vehicles quarterly. This said, your dealer’s allocation for your vehicle could be for a 3rd or 4th quarter build and won’t schedule quick like a regular GT or V6.
